- Screenwriter Nora Ephron Dead At 71
Oscar-nominated writer of 'Sleepless in Seattle' and 'When Harry Met Sally ... ' died of pneumonia.
By Josh WiglerAcademy Award-nominated screenwriter and director Nora Ephron died Tuesday (June 26) from pneumonia. She was 71. News of Ephron's passing first hit the Internet late Tuesday when journalist Liz Smith, a friend of Ephron's, published a column remembering the late director.
"She never gave the answer I expected to anything. She was grave in her humor, which made it deadly, unexpected, truly funny and dauntingly intelligent," wrote Smith. "She seemed never to want or expect anything, while always demanding the best from the rest of us. She was — always — right and somehow left the smartest, most ambitious and silliest of us in the dust at her feet."
Ephron lived a storied life both on set and behind the scenes. Born in New York City in 1941 and raised in Beverly Hills, California, Ephron worked as a journalist for numerous years before trying her hand writing and directing for film. Her writing appeared in such outlets as Esquire and New York, and she was even married to Carl Bernstein of Watergate fame from 1976 until 1980. She later wed screenwriter Nicholas Pileggi in 1987; they remained married until the time of her death.
In 1983, Ephron's first major Hollywood movie, "Silkwood," arrived in theaters. Starring marquee names including Meryl Streep, Kurt Russell and Cher, Ephron's "Silkwood" was based on the true story of Karen Silkwood, who was killed in a suspicious accident during her investigation into the unethical practices of the nuclear power plant that employed her. The film was nominated for five Oscars, including one for Ephron's screenplay.
Over the course of her career, Ephron cemented her place in Hollywood as one of the industry's finest romantic comedy writers. She wrote the iconic "When Harry Met Sally ... " and directed numerous films, including the Tom Hanks and Meg Ryan-starring "Sleepless in Seattle" and "You've Got Mail." Her final film as writer and director was "Julie & Julia."

Переслать - Justin Bieber Confirms Next Single
Singer will drop Big Sean collabo, 'As Long as You Love Me,' in July.
By Jocelyn VenaJustin Bieber has officially picked his next single off Believe. The singer will release his Big Sean collabo, "As Long as You Love Me," to radio on July 9, Billboard.com reports.
The song is the first official follow-up to his single "Boyfriend" and has already seen some movement on the charts after Bieber released it as a promo single on June 11 in the lead-up to his June 19 album release. It charted at #21 on the Hot 100, banking 168,000 downloads. The song will get a major push on Top 40 and rhythmic radio stations in the coming weeks.
"Bieber's a true G. People may not know that," Big Sean told MTV News about working with the 18-year-old on the Rodney "Darkchild" Jerkins-produced track. "He is a good dude, man. And I ain't toning down nothing. I'm diverse — I can write raps to any type of song."
MTV News recently chatted with Bieber's manager, Scooter Braun, about the album's potential next single, and he shared that "As Long as You Love Me" was at the top of the list of candidates to get the official single treatment.
"We haven't picked the next single," he said. "We're gonna see how different songs react off the album. 'As Long as You Love Me' [with Big Sean] is getting a lot of love, so is 'All Around the World' [with Ludacris]. So is 'Die in Your Arms.' 'Beauty and the Beat' is coming with the album. We're gonna see what the next single is. We're gonna figure that out."
In addition to preparing to shoot a video for the track, Bieber is also still in promo mode, spreading the word about his album, as well as prepping for his world tour, which kicks off in September in the U.S.
"The tour starts at the end of September ... by the end of 2013 we're gonna hit the whole world," Braun explained. "He has been watching a tremendous amount of Michael Jackson concerts from the '80s and '90s. And he has been talking to me about how Michael incorporated magic and pyro and reveals and he wants to bring in that. [But] still do that acoustic thing, but he wants to take it to a whole new level.
"It's just really exciting," he continued. "Nothing makes him happier than being onstage. So it's gonna be fun to get back onto the road. I think he was an amazing performer before, but his level of dance and musicianship and his range [has grown]. He's a veteran now. I think he wants to take it to a completely new level."

Related ArtistsПереслать - Flaming Lips Reveal Guests For World-Record Road Trip
During O Music Awards, 'Jackass' star Chris Pontius, Neon Trees and Jackson Browne will join the Lips as they try to land Guinness spot.
By Brendan Dempsey
Wayne Coyne of Flaming Lips
Photo:It's no secret that the Flaming Lips have their sights set on the Guinness World Record for most concerts performed in multiple cities in a 24-hour time period. The innovative rockers have just announced they will be joined by "Jackass" and "Wildboyz" star Chris Pontius, Jackson Browne, Neon Trees, Karmin and a slew of additional artists as they gun for the record, currently held by Jay-Z, who played seven shows from Atlanta to L.A. in 2006.
The Flaming Lips and friends plan to play eight shows from Memphis, Tennessee, to New Orleans, beginning Wednesday at 7:30 p.m. ET and continuing for 24 hours. The gigs will take place in conjunction with the O Music Awards, a 24-hour awards ceremony that will be broadcast on MTV, VH1 and CMT and livestream at Omusicawards.com. The Flaming Lips will jump aboard their aptly named bus, "Endeavor," and travel to each new location just as the opening band is finishing its set. They'll perform what promises to be a raucous and exciting mini-set before moving on to the next location.
The O Music Awards ceremony will give out 24 awards, one for each hour of the festival. Categories that artists are vying to win include Must Follow Artist on Twitter, Best Online Concert Experience, Most Adorable Viral Star, Fan Army FTW, Best Music App and Digital Genius Award.
"The O Music Awards are all about celebrating the wonderfully messy and soulful spirit of music," said Van Toffler, President of Viacom's Music and Logo Group. "This insane bus brigade and the assorted collection of artists and pranksters that are taking part not only make me incredibly happy, but pretty much sum up what a good 24 hour binge should involve, minus the libations."
Along with the pomp and circumstance of winning awards, the first 12 installments of Stop/Watch will air during the concerts. Stop/Watch is a 60-second online music series in which artists have one minute flat to perform a complete song — with a countdown clock running! The first 12 Stop/Watch artists are: Joseph Arthur, Carolina Chocolate Drops, Citizen's Band, John Forte, the Hives, Rhett Miller, Miracles of Modern Science, Peasant, Punch Brothers, Saint Motel, P.T. Walkley and the Wombats.

Related ArtistsПереслать - 'Catching Fire': Jena Malone In Running To Play Johanna
Mia Wasikowska is reportedly no longer being considered for role in 'Hunger Games' sequel.
By Kevin P. SullivanFans of "The Hunger Games" have been keeping a close eye on two yet-to-be-cast roles in the upcoming sequel "Catching Fire" as the follow-up gets ready to move into production. Rumors about the part of Finnick Odair have floated around for months, but talk about who might be cast as Johanna Mason has only picked up this week.
The latest word on who might play the former champion for District 7 comes from Entertainment Weekly, which is reporting that Jena Malone is in the running for the role.
Last week, the first rumors about the role began to circulate. According to the Playlist, both Mia Wasikowska and model Zoe Aggeliki were in the mix for Johanna. In its report about Malone, EW also confirmed that Wasikowska was neither in the running nor able to fit "Catching Fire" into her schedule.
Malone, who recently appeared in the wildly popular "Hatfields & McCoys" miniseries, is 27 years old, making her the appropriate age to play Johanna, who Katniss at one point describes as being like a big sister, albeit one who hates her.
Johanna is a master of manipulation. She won her first tournament by pretending to be weak and non-threatening until there were fewer tributes left in the arena. Seizing the opportunity, she revealed herself as a proficient killer. When she first meets Katniss in the arena, she memorably strips naked in order to make Jennifer Lawrence's character uncomfortable.
No new additions to the cast have been officially announced for the Francis Lawrence-directed sequel to this year's massive blockbuster. Lionsgate is not currently commenting on casting.
"Catching Fire" will open in theaters on November 22, 2013.
